all of these videos worked perfectly fine in PM 26.5
in PM 27.3 the video randomly pauses (lags) for a second or two sometimes while the audio keeps playing.
in PM 27.3 all videos stop playing at 99 seconds.
using a 100% clean new profile in PM 27.3 does not resolve the issue.
in firefox 54.0 the videos play perfectly fine.

As a workaround you could try to install HTML5 Media Tuner and disable MSE for problematic sites. In this case it helped me.
